Toothaches are sometimes chronic and long-lasting; however, they are often acute, meaning they come on suddenly, causing excruciating pain. Before you get treatment for your toothache in Naperville, your dentist will need to perform a comprehensive examination, which may include X-rays. Here are some causes of toothaches and some treatment options you may be offered to ease your pain.

Toothache Causes

Many toothaches are caused by dental decay, however, there are many other causes. For example, if you have an infection in the middle part of your tooth known as the pulp, you may experience severe pain. This type of tooth infection is often called an abscessed tooth, and in addition to pain, it can cause a bad taste in your mouth as a result of purulent (containing pus), fever, and gum inflammation. Sinus infections can also cause a toothache, especially in the top row of your teeth.

Toothache Treatment Options

Treatment for a toothache in Naperville may include filling a cavity and a root canal. If you have a pulp infection or an abscessed tooth, your dentist will clean out the infected material from the center of the tooth and fill it with a special material to seal the hole. Antibiotics may also be prescribed to eliminate the infection. Once the infection has been eliminated, your toothache should subside. Deep cleaning treatments known as scaling and root planing can also help your gums heal from periodontal disease. Once your gums have healed, dental pain often subsides. Nasal decongestants can relieve sinus inflammation and alleviate upper tooth pain from sinus pressure.
